MARGARONI, SOFIA Biogeographical insights into the spore ecology of Selaginella Simple plants can provide novel insights into fundamental ecological processes that might be hidden in more complex plants. I used the world-wide geographic distributions of species of Selaginella, a primitive vascular plant, to show that species-coexistence is affected by competition among spores for regeneration sites, and to test whether colonization of distant islands is more difficult for species with unisexual spores than for species with bisexual spores.
